Application scenarios

Multimedia technology is now an integral part of many of the spaces we experience every day: museums, universities, corporate headquarters, congress centres, theatres, institutional environments. In these contexts, audiovisual systems are not simply technical tools, but elements that help define the user experience, the quality of communication and the functioning of the spaces themselves.

Multimedia design is born precisely at the intersection of architecture, technology and content. Designing these systems means understanding the needs of the people who will use the spaces and translating them into reliable, integrated technological solutions consistent with the architectural context.

The members of MIDA – Multimedia Italian Designers Alliance operate across a wide range of design contexts, contributing to the definition of technologically advanced environments in the cultural, institutional, educational and corporate fields.

The application scenarios presented in this section illustrate some of the contexts in which multimedia design plays a central role. Through these examples it is possible to understand the design skills involved and the challenges that characterise the technological design of contemporary spaces.
